I tried several buttercream recipes and couldn’t find one that I just loved. I think that is because most of them use 1/2 butter and 1/2 shortening, and I just love butter too much to substitute the taste. I also think that you need to use butter that you like, I tend to lean towards organic brands or Challenge Butter brands. In addition, I use salted butter, but this part is based on preference. I adapted a recipe, it was good, but I just replaced the shortening with real butter.

This is by far my favorite recipe. To add coloring, I recommend using color paste (I get mine from Hobby Lobby) it doesn’t make your frosting runny. If you only have liquid coloring you may just need to add a bit more confectioners’ sugar.

Buttercream Icing

Prep: 2 minutes
Cook: 5 minutes
Total: 7 minutes
Servings: 20
Calories: 175 kcal
This amazing Buttercream Frosting makes a great addition to any dessert, as its smooth and fluffy consistency compliments your dessert without overpowering it.

Ingredients
 

  • 1 cup butter softened
  • 1 teaspoon clear vanilla extract
  • 4 cups pow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ons milk

Instructions
 

  • Using an electric mixer beat together butter and vanilla until combined.
  • Slowly blend in the sugar, one cup at a time, beating well after each addition. 
  • Beat in the milk and continue mixing until light and fluffy. You may need to add more sugar or milk until you find the right consistency, this varies every time I do the recipe
  • If you are not going to use the frosting right away keep covered until you are ready to do so.
